Commando System Update
Following the two incidents that affected power supply at Rand Water’s Eikenhof pump station and Vereeniging Treatment Plant this week, the Commando System has not yet recovered.
This is affecting water supply in the Commando System (which comprises, Hursthill, Crosby and Brixton).
Bulk supplier, Rand Water, has agreed to pump an additional 100Megalitres overnight, in order to boost capacity in this system. Johannesburg Water will also continue with closing the Hursthill 2 reservoir outlet overnight, to boost capacity for tomorrow.
These interventions will assist in the recovery of the commando system for tomorrow.
The team will monitor the recovery of the system and updates will be provided to customers.

Update: Wynberg, Bramley North, Alexandra
Following the repairs that were conducted on Friday, 24 May on a 375mm main water pipe which affected Wynberg, Bramley North, and parts of Alexandra (1st to 3rd Streets), water samples were sent to the laboratory for testing.
Contaminants were found in the water samples that were tested. The Johannesburg Water team will immediately flush the system to ensure that the water is safe to drink.
In the meantime, residents and customers are requested to refrain from using the water until communication is shared that the water is safe to consume. Alternative water supply will continue to be provided.
Johannesburg Water will monitor the situation and provide further updates as they become available.
